Source of Funds



Eb5 VisaInvestor Visa
Developing the source of funds is a critical aspect of the EB5 visa procedure for UK residents. Applicants have to give detailed paperwork that demonstrates the lawful origin of their financial investment funding. This involves detailed economic records, consisting of financial institution statements, income tax return, and evidence of earnings. It is important to trace the funds back to their initial source, whether stemmed from business profits, financial investments, or personal savings. The United State Citizenship and Migration Solutions (USCIS) looks at these papers to verify that the funds were not gotten with illegal methods. Because of this, UK residents must be prepared to provide a clear and clear monetary history, assuring compliance with the EB5 program's qualification demands. Correct preparation can substantially enhance the opportunities of a successful application.




Financial Investment Options: Direct vs. Regional Center



Guiding through the financial investment landscape of the EB5 visa program reveals two primary options for UK residents: straight financial investments and regional center jobs. Straight financial investments involve purchasing a new company, where the financier generally takes an active duty in the business procedures. This path might offer higher returns but needs a lot more hands-on monitoring and a comprehensive understanding of the service landscape.


In comparison, local facility tasks permit capitalists to add to pre-approved entities that manage multiple EB5 investments. This option generally requires less involvement from the investor and can provide a more passive financial investment experience. Both methods have distinctive advantages and obstacles, demanding mindful factor to consider based on private financial goals and risk resistance.

The Application Process: Step-by-Step



Steering the EB5 visa process calls for careful interest to information, as each step is necessary for success. First, candidates have to select either a local facility or a direct financial investment option, depending upon their financial investment strategy. Next off, they have to gather required paperwork, consisting of evidence of funds and an extensive company strategy. As soon as prepared, candidates send Form I-526, the Immigrant Petition by Alien Financier, to the USA Citizenship and Migration Provider (USCIS) After authorization, applicants can obtain a visa at an U.S. consulate or adjust their condition if already in the U.S. Upon arrival, financiers need to keep their financial investment for a marked duration, typically two years, to fulfill the EB5 requirements.

Maintaining Your EB5 Standing and Path to Citizenship



Efficiently maintaining EB5 condition is essential for financiers intending to accomplish permanent residency in the USA. To maintain this condition, capitalists should guarantee that their funding investment stays in danger and that the financial investment creates the necessary variety of jobs within the stated duration. Normal interaction with the regional facility or project managers is necessary to stay informed regarding compliance and efficiency metrics.


In addition, investors must file Type I-829, the Request by Business Owner to Get Rid Of Problems, within the 90-day home window before the two-year wedding anniversary of getting conditional residency. This request needs paperwork demonstrating that all investment conditions have been met. Finally, maintaining a clean legal document and sticking to united state legislations will considerably enhance the path to eventual citizenship.

For how long Does the EB5 Visa Process Normally Take?



The EB5 visa procedure normally takes around 12 to 24 months. Elements such as processing times at United state Citizenship and Migration Solutions and the quantity of applications can trigger variants in this duration.

Can Family Members Members Join Me on My EB5 Visa?



Yes, relative can accompany a specific on an EB5 visa. This consists of partners and youngsters under 21, permitting them to gain irreversible residency along with the primary candidate throughout the visa procedure.


What Takes place if My Financial Investment Falls short?



If the investment falls short, the person might lose the invested capital and possibly threaten their visa condition. They should seek advice from a migration lawyer to check out choices for maintaining residency or attending to the investment loss.


Are There Age Constraints for Dependents Using With Me?



There are age restrictions for dependents applying with the major candidate. Only unmarried youngsters under 21 years old can qualify as dependents, meaning those over this age has to apply independently for their own visas.
